Amichai is a masculine name of Hebrew origin, meaning "my people live" or "my nation lives." This name carries a profound sense of vitality and communal strength, resonating with historical and cultural significance. It is a name that embodies a spirit of resilience and continuity, often chosen for its strong ties to heritage and identity. In recent decades, Amichai has been recognized in literary and artistic circles, most notably through the works of the renowned Israeli poet Yehuda Amichai. His contributions to literature have brought attention to the name, highlighting its poetic and intellectual associations. The name Amichai, though not extremely common, is cherished for its meaningful legacy and the cultural pride it evokes.
